What is employee engagement?
Employee engagement is a workplace approach designed to ensure that employees are committed towards the organizational goals and values, encouraged to contribute to organizational success, and also enhance their own sense of well-being. In addition, providing better work environment to employees offer more of their capability and potential.

How to engage employees using social media?
Most of the organizations are aware of the pros and cons of social media platforms. They are very well aware of the fact that things on social media spread like a wild fire. This is true, but a careful consideration of social media guidelines can do wonders for businesses. You can engage employees in numerous ways such as –
- Giving employees the freedom to express by defining guidelines on how employees interact
- Announcing company news by linking to a news release on your website
- Recognizing individuals or team of employees for their work
- Welcoming newcomers or congratulating someone on promotion
- Acknowledging customers or sharing business success stories
- Posting photos and videos
- Sharing industry news and asking employees to share their opinions
- Encouraging health and wellness
What social media platforms can be used?
It is always recommended using applications those are meant exclusively for internal communication. This would ensure a safe, reliable and personalized platform for discussion. Employees and clients can actively participate, discuss, share and raise concerns. Before getting started, you must specify the social media guidelines to control or inhibit employees. What can be shared and cannot be shared should be specified.
These days, considering the growth of BYOD trend, social media applications are a perfect ploy for fostering employee engagement. The applications can be bolstered with features those are exclusively meant for the organization.
